There is a good saying in China: "If it's a mule or a horse, take it out for a walk."

A month later, there was a CS tournament at the internet café across the street. It was said there was corporate sponsorship, and the champion would get a 1,000-yuan prize, but the runner-up wouldn't get a cent. We didn't think much about it, just rubbed our hands: "It's time to go out for a 'walk'..."

The internet café had a rule: registered teams could practice there at a discounted rate of 3 yuan/hour for the month before the tournament, and teams could play practice matches against each other, with the café providing the referees.

It was the perfect chance for us to test our skills.

When registering, Yang Mo asked me: "Boss, what's our team called?"

In the eyes of the other teams nearby, a look I was familiar with immediately appeared: it was the same look the onlookers had when the fatty and I were playing CS...

In that instant, the passionate years I had spent on Lost Temple flashed through my mind. To commemorate the eternal StarCraft, I announced with great pride:

We are the "LOST" team!

"Pfft!" Someone nearby had already laughed out loud.

"Naming themselves the 'Lost' team before even competing..." someone whispered.

"K.O! you~lost~~!" another guy called out in a weird tone.

I turned around abruptly and, before Andy could go berserk, pointed at him and said: "How about it, let's play a practice match?" I never show my anger on my face.

"ok!~~ Let's go!" Although this guy spoke broken foreign gibberish (oh, sorry), he was quite straightforward.

>>>>>>

The match unfolded on De_dust.

"I'm walking on this bustling street~~" I hummed a song while following my teammate ** with a pistol. After a few days of getting familiar, I had mastered the basic controls of the game, and my teammates were all experts among experts in the internet café, so I shouldn't have anything to worry about~~

We soon arrived at a fork in the map. There were three paths ahead, and the police were likely hiding behind a wall on one of them...

We looked at each other and all five of us walked toward the middle path. Since it was the first round, no one had much money, so we all bought the most powerful pistol—the Desert Eagle. Of course, none of us bought armor. Firepower is everything! We firmly believed.

So when we reached the final turn, a flashbang seemed to fly from the ancient past toward the ancient future, and then exploded before our eyes, filled with ancient loneliness...

"That day you used a white cloth to cover my eyes and also covered the sky..."

Then came another flash.

And then two grenades.

Without armor, we were conquered by grenades just like that...

Afterward, the two guys from the other team guarding this path jumped in ungraciously to finish off our teammates who hadn't been blown up, then calmly threw away their pistols and picked up our Desert Eagles...

First round, police win.

In the following second and third rounds, because we had no money, although we tried to resist with pistols, it only proved the gap between pistols and submachine guns once again...

Only Xiao K cunningly hid on a crate and took out one person while the police were slaughtering us. Of course, he received a higher level of treatment: he was stabbed to death by four police officers and then whipped with machine gun fire. But he still smiled, identical to Yang Mo's fox-like smile: "After I died, I still successfully wasted their bullets..."

Fourth round, we finally saved enough money for full equipment, each holding the symbol of the terrorists: the AK47. If we lost again this time, we would have almost no chance of a comeback, so when we reached the fork again, we chose to split up.

Andy and Yang Mo went left, Xiao K and Xu Ge went middle, and I, as the captain, stayed behind to provide support.――Actually, it was because Xu Ge said: Don't follow me, you're in the way! And Yang Mo said: You go with Xiao K and the others, their group is stronger.

Helpless, I could only stay where I was, pull out my dagger, wave it at the sky, and shout with tears: I hold my sword and laugh at the sky, leaving my liver and gallbladder to the two Kunlun mountains!

So, when Andy's group reached the exit, he relied on his invincible rushing and jumped out, spraying wildly with his AK. When he discovered there were two opponents, he was already lying down, muttering: If you've got the guts, duel me!

Yang Mo killed one using a time difference before he too died with regret.

Looking at the other side, Xu Ge was hit by a flashbang again, so he danced a tragic dance of death in a holy white light... Xiao K didn't go out at all, hiding behind a corner and quietly watching Xu Ge fall...

The guy who killed Xu Ge waited for a while, and seeing no one else come out, he threw down his gun to pick up Xu Ge's AK. Xiao K was waiting for exactly this. The gun in his hand aimed with unusual accuracy at the policeman's abdomen. After three shots, he switched to his knife cleanly. While stabbing, he muttered: Let you stab me! Let you whip my corpse! After stabbing him to death, he felt it wasn't enough, so he sprayed a magazine of bullets onto the enemy's corpse. So, when he was reloading, two policemen with cold, smug smiles appeared before him at the right time...

Retribution came so fast!

So I was pleasantly surprised to find from the battle report in the top right corner of the screen: I was the only one left alive on the team.

Which meant, if I took out the remaining three policemen by myself, I would be a hero!

A surge of hot blood rushed to my heart, "Death is not scary! If my head is cut off, it's just a scar the size of a bowl! Eighteen years later, I'll be a hero again! Pressure? What's pressure! A lion only shows its strength when it's forced to the edge of a cliff, letting its opponent know: what a lion is!.."

Xu Ge sighed lightly: Sigh, the boss is getting excited...

So the result of this round taught everyone a truth: what a hero must do first is to survive...

The continuous eco rounds continued to stage scenes of submachine guns bullying pistols, the only difference being: this time Xiao K was stabbed to death on the crate, and he was whipped by five people instead of four... (Note 1)

Seventh round, police win. This time they just rushed out and sprayed wildly, winning cleanly.

After the thirteenth round ended, one side's score was still zero.

>>>>>>

"hi~ baby~ you lost~~" that fake foreigner twisted over again.

"Hope to see you in the tournament!" their captain patted my shoulder politely. Actually, this guy killed the most of us during the match...

"Yeah~~ meeting you in the first round was easy~~ but the chances of meeting you in the second round... hehehe" another smug guy, he seemed to be the unlucky policeman Xiao K had ambushed twice.

"I also hope to meet you in the tournament, really." I said word by word, "Let's go!"

When we walked out of the internet café, the voice of the opposing captain came from behind: "Remember! Our team is called 'NoNoYes!'"

"What kind of ghost name is that? nonoyes? The name really fits the person..." Xu Ge was still complaining.

"Xu Ge!" I suddenly interrupted him, "Among those few people, it's obvious that the captain has the best technique. If you were to duel that captain, who would win?"

"It would definitely be me! That guy isn't..."

"Andy, what about you dueling him?" I didn't even pay attention to Xu Ge.

"I could take two of him!" The fatty was almost jumping up.

"Very good, Yang Mo, what about you?"

"I could beat Andy." Yang Mo's glasses flashed with a cold light.

"Xiao K?"

"Duel? He wouldn't be able to find me, I could ambush him..."

"..."

I stood still and took a deep breath.

"Then why did we lose?"

"Because you're too weak!" the four of them said in unison.

"No!" I was still calm, although the veins on my forehead were bulging, "Because we had no coordination."

"Tomorrow, everyone collect five tactical coordination strategies from famous domestic and international teams, and we'll practice them one by one!" I gritted my teeth, "I don't believe we can't win!"

Xu Ge whispered in Yang Mo's ear: "See that? I told you, didn't I? This guy is the worst at losing..."

"Xu Ge, you're responsible for copying out the collected tactics!" My ears could legendarily hear a kitten blinking in the dark.

"Received..." Xu Ge wasn't afraid of anything else, just afraid of me getting excited.

"Alright, that's it, dismissed!"

Note 1: Eco round is an economic round, where everyone doesn't buy guns to ensure equipment for the next round. It is roughly divided into offensive eco and defensive eco. In rare cases, there are also eco rounds where players buy Desert Eagles or other light weapons to try to turn the tide. 3D is known as the team with the strongest pistols in the world, and they often use the Desert Eagle comeback tactic.
